What is SHOUTcast?
SHOUTcast is a audio homesteading solution. It permits anyone on the internet
to broadcast audio from their PC to listeners across the Internet or any
other IP-based network (Office LANs, college campuses, etc.).
SHOUTcast's underlying technology for audio delivery is MPEG Layer 3,
also known as MP3 technology. The SHOUTcast system can deliver audio in
a live situation, or can deliver audio on-demand for archived broadcasts.

Quick facts:
To find how many users you are limited to, you simply divide the max outgoing
transfer limit by the bit rate you are streaming at.
ie: 256 / 24 = 10.67.
Rounded down to 10 max users.
The higher you set your bit rate the less users you can hold. To increase
your user limit, decrease the bit rate. Bit rates can be changed on the
fly, while streaming.
